瞬态响应:瞬态响应-matlab开发
瞬态响应是系统理论中的一个重要概念,特别是在信号处理、控制系统设计和模拟中有着广泛的应用。在MATLAB这个强大的计算环境中,我们可以对各种系统的瞬态响应进行深入研究和分析。MATLAB提供了丰富的工具和函数,使得用户能够方便地计算、可视化和理解瞬态响应。 瞬态响应是指当系统受到阶跃、脉冲或任意初始条件的影响时,其输出随着时间变化的过程,直到系统达到稳态。在控制工程中,瞬态响应通常用来评估系统的稳定性和动态性能。它包含了超调量、调节时间、上升时间和阻尼比等关键参数,这些参数对于理解和优化系统性能至关重要。 MATLAB中,我们可以通过Simulink或控制系统工具箱来分析瞬态响应。Simulink是一个图形化建模环境,用户可以建立复杂系统模型,并通过仿真来观察瞬态响应。在Simulink中,我们可以添加各种模块,如传递函数、状态空间模型或者离散系统,然后设置输入信号和初始条件,运行仿真来获取输出的瞬态行为。 控制系统工具箱则提供了函数如`step`、`impulse`和`lsim`,它们分别用于分析系统在阶跃输入、脉冲输入和任意输入下的瞬态响应。例如,`step`函数可以绘制出系统在阶跃输入下的输出随时间的变化曲线,帮助我们直观地理解系统的动态特性。 在MATLAB中处理瞬态响应时,我们还可能用到`ode45`等数值积分器来解决微分方程,这些函数能精确地计算系统的动态行为。此外,`bode`函数可用于绘制频率域的幅频特性和相频特性,进一步了解系统的频率响应,这在分析瞬态响应时也非常重要。 压缩包文件"Transient_Response.zip"很可能包含了与瞬态响应分析相关的MATLAB代码、Simulink模型或者实验数据。解压后,用户可以查看其中的.m文件来学习如何使用MATLAB进行瞬态响应的计算和分析。这些文件可能包括了系统的数学模型定义、输入信号的生成、仿真设置以及结果的可视化代码。 瞬态响应是理解动态系统行为的关键,MATLAB提供了一系列强大的工具来支持这方面的研究。通过学习和应用这些工具,工程师和研究人员能够更好地设计和优化控制系统,以满足特定性能指标。在实际工程问题中,掌握瞬态响应的分析方法对于提升系统性能具有重大意义。
- 1
- 粉丝: 153
- 资源: 916
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- (源码)基于Arduino和Nextion的HMI人机界面系统.zip
- (源码)基于 JavaFX 和 MySQL 的影院管理系统.zip
- (源码)基于EAV模型的动态广告位系统.zip
- (源码)基于Qt的长沙地铁换乘系统.zip
- (源码)基于ESP32和DM02A模块的智能照明系统.zip
- (源码)基于.NET Core和Entity Framework Core的学校管理系统.zip
- (源码)基于C#的WiFi签到管理系统.zip
- (源码)基于WPF和MVVM框架的LikeYou.WAWA管理系统.zip
- (源码)基于C#的邮件管理系统.zip
- 【yan照门】chen冠希(1323张) [2月25日凌晨新增容祖儿全94张].rar.torrent